Positive-displacement superchargers are usually rated by their capacity per revolution. The output of a piston engine drops because of the reduction in the mass of air that can be drawn into the engine. The main advantage of an engine with a mechanically driven supercharger is better throttle response, as well as the ability to reach full-boost pressure instantaneously.
